Long time ago I learned that if you replace the good MB bolts and
nuts with 5/16" 'merkun bolts, the next time you need to do the job,
the 'merkun bolts will twist off with 1/4 turn. Much faster. Rust
up solid. Just a little turn, and they pop right off. Of course you
have to have new bolts and nuts.
It took me a few hours to remove the two bolts that attach the
header pipe to the exhaust manifold. The first one came loose after
mutiple penetrant applications- over a few days. The second was
really stubborn- it was starting to come but ultimately snapped
which is fine as the bolt just passes through the flanges- not
threaded thru anything. Overall was a moderate PITA. How do
mechanics do this so quickly? Impact guns?
Air tools.... or a flame wrench.
